Transaction 40c1355a6279cb5fe13773b750eed33a58bde7012e1a34b266369b5029adb11d
1 Input
1 Output
-
40c1355a6279cb5fe13773b750eed33a58bde7012e1a34b266369b5029adb11d:0
- value
- 145172846
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ef3eaf55f5236f55866bca0d00369fc0443500c2
- address
- bc1qaul27404ydh4tpntegxsqd5lcpzr2qxzdtulse